The Power of Strategic Automation

Think of automation as your tireless digital workforce, operating around the clock to keep your business moving forward. Unlike human assistants, these systems don't require breaks, vacation time, or sick days. They execute their programmed tasks with consistent precision, helping to eliminate the human error that often creeps in when we're trying to manage too many things at once.

Building Your Automation Foundation

Before you start implementing any tools or systems, take a step back and examine your business operations holistically. Consider your daily workflow like a complex symphony - each element needs to work in perfect harmony with the others to create something beautiful.

Start by conducting a thorough audit of your daily activities. Which tasks consume most of your time? Which processes feel repetitive and draining? These are your prime candidates for automation. Common areas where automation can make a significant impact include:

  • Communication Management
  • Digital Marketing and Content Distribution
  • Financial Operations and Bookkeeping
  • Client Relations and Management

Communication Management

Your inbox doesn't have to be a source of stress. Imagine smart filters automatically sorting incoming messages, templated responses handling routine inquiries, and follow-up sequences nurturing client relationships while you focus on more pressing matters.

Digital Marketing and Content Distribution

Consider how much time you spend manually posting across various social media platforms. With the right automation tools, you can maintain an active online presence without being glued to your phone or computer. Your content can reach your audience at optimal times, regardless of your personal schedule.

Financial Operations and Bookkeeping

Picture a system that automatically generates invoices, tracks expenses, processes payments, and creates financial reports. No more spending your weekends catching up on bookkeeping or scrambling during tax season.

Client Relations and Management

From initial contact to ongoing service delivery, automation can streamline your client experience. Automated scheduling systems, intake forms, and onboarding sequences ensure consistent, professional interactions while saving you countless hours.

Choosing Your Automation Arsenal

When selecting automation tools, think of yourself as a curator building a collection. Each piece needs to serve a specific purpose while complementing the others. Here are some key considerations:

  • Integration Capabilities: Your tools should work together seamlessly. Isolated solutions often create more problems than they solve.
  • Scalability: Choose systems that can grow with your business. What works for you today should still be viable when your client base doubles or triples.
  • User-Friendliness: The best automation tool is one you'll actually use. Look for interfaces that feel intuitive and natural to you.
  • Return on Investment: Calculate not just the monetary cost, but the time savings each tool provides. Sometimes, a more expensive solution that saves significant time is worth the investment.

The Implementation Journey

Start your automation journey like you'd eat an elephant - one bite at a time. Begin with a single process that causes you the most stress or consumes the most time. Master that automation before moving on to the next.

For instance, you might start with email management. Set up filters and templates, then observe how they perform for a few weeks. Make adjustments as needed. Once you're comfortable, move on to another area, such as appointment scheduling or social media management.

Measuring Success and Optimization

Track the impact of your automation efforts using relevant metrics. Are you saving time? Has client satisfaction improved? Are there fewer errors in your processes? Use these insights to refine and optimize your systems continuously.
